### Reading
@@ -52,37 +49,45 @@ It's also possible to create a client from a DSN (Data Source Name):
To fetch records from InfluxDB you can do a query directly on a database:
```php
// fetch the database
$database = $client->selectDB('influx_test_db');
// executing a query will yield a resultset object
$result = $database->query('select * from test_metric LIMIT 5');
// get the points from the resultset yields an array
$points = $result->getPoints();
// fetch the database
$database = $client->selectDB('influx_test_db');
// executing a query will yield a resultset object
$result = $database->query('select * from test_metric LIMIT 5');
// get the points from the resultset yields an array
$points = $result->getPoints();
```
It's also possible to use the QueryBuilder object. This is a class that simplifies the process of building queries.
```php
// retrieve points with the query builder
$result = $database->getQueryBuilder()
->select('cpucount')
->from('test_metric')
->limit(2)
->getResultSet()
->getPoints();
// retrieve points with the query builder
$result = $database->getQueryBuilder()
->select('cpucount')
->from('test_metric')
->limit(2)
->getResultSet()
->getPoints();
// get the query from the QueryBuilder
$query = $database->getQueryBuilder()
->select('cpucount')
->from('test_metric')
->getQuery();
// get the query from the QueryBuilder
$query = $database->getQueryBuilder()
->select('cpucount')
->from('test_metric')
->where(["region = 'us-west'"])
->getQuery();
```
Make sure that you enter single quotes when doing a where query on strings; otherwise InfluxDB will return an empty result.
You can get the last executed query from the client:
```php
// use the getLastQuery() method
$lastQuery = $client->getLastQuery();
// or access the static variable directly:
$lastQuery = Client::lastQuery;
```

*Note:* It is import to note that precision will be *ignored* when you use UDP. You should always use nanosecond
@@ -194,59 +195,64 @@ It's important to provide the correct precision when adding a timestamp to a Poi
if you specify a timestamp in seconds and the default (nanosecond) precision is set; the entered timestamp will be invalid.
```php
// Points will require a nanosecond precision (this is default as per influxdb standard)
$newPoints = $database->writePoints($points);
// Points will require a nanosecond precision (this is default as per influxdb standard)
$newPoints = $database->writePoints($points);
// Points will require second precision
$newPoints = $database->writePoints($points, Database::PRECISION_SECONDS);
// Points will require microsecond precision
$newPoints = $database->writePoints($points, Database::PRECISION_MICROSECONDS);
// Points will require second precision
$newPoints = $database->writePoints($points, Database::PRECISION_SECONDS);
// Points will require microsecond precision
$newPoints = $database->writePoints($points, Database::PRECISION_MICROSECONDS);
```
Please note that `exec('date + %s%N')` does NOT work under MacOS; you can use PHP's `microtime` to get a timestamp with microsecond precision, like such:
```php
list($usec, $sec) = explode(' ', microtime());
$timestamp = sprintf('%d%06d', $sec, $usec*1000000);
```
